How To Use Video
Videos can be placed on a web site.
Videos can be placed on a CD-ROM for those who do not have Internet access.
Videos can be played on a TV or LCD projector.
Use videos to provide asynchronous information (i.e. use video to make yourself available to students and the general public 24/7 -- virtual YOU).
If you have information in a course that is constant from year to year, consider making videos and placing them on your web site for students to watch either inside or outside of class.
When creating a course packet, include a CD-ROM full of course related videos.
Make use of SOE and Purdue computer labs during course time to give students access to course videos.
Use videos in PowerPoint presentations.
Use 100% video presentations to make your message more powerful.
Use video in video conferences (i.e. Polycom ViewStation units have video inputs).
